The successful candidate will assist with the maintenance, repair, and upkeep of car parks across the estate, ensuring they remain safe, clean, and presentable.

Duties:

  • Carrying out minor surface repairs
  • Line marking
  • Vegetation control
  • Litter picking, leaf blowing, debris clearance
  • General grounds maintenance activities
  • Supporting planned maintenance works
  • Responding to defects as required
  • Providing a professional and courteous service when interacting with customers and members of the public
  • Working outdoors in varying weather conditions
